Frequently Asked Questions about Santa Clara
How much are Studio apartments in Santa Clara?
There are currently 1,753 Studio Apartments in Santa Clara with rent ranges from $972 to $7,000 with an average price of $2,880.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Santa Clara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Santa Clara ranges from $1,036 to $8,100 with an average monthly rent of $3,607.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Santa Clara c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Santa Clara range from $1,233 to $13,038.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,692.
How expensive are Santa Clara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 732 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Santa Clara on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,460 to $13,430 - averaging $6,029 for the location.
